CALCIUM STEAROYL LACTYLATE

Description

Calcium Stearoyl Lactylate is a versatile cosmetic ingredient used in both skincare and haircare formulations. This white to off-white powder is derived from natural sources, combining calcium, stearic acid, and lactic acid. Its primary function is as an emulsifier, helping to blend oil and water-based components in various products.

In skincare, Calcium Stearoyl Lactylate acts as a gentle surfactant, aiding in the cleansing process without stripping the skin of its natural oils. It also functions as a moisturizer, helping to improve skin hydration and softness. The ingredient's emulsifying properties contribute to the stability and texture of creams and lotions, ensuring a smooth and consistent application.

For haircare, Calcium Stearoyl Lactylate serves as a conditioning agent, helping to reduce frizz and improve manageability. It can enhance the overall texture of hair products, providing a silky feel without excessive buildup. Additionally, its mild nature makes it suitable for sensitive scalps.

This ingredient is generally well-tolerated and considered safe for use in cosmetic formulations. Its multifunctional properties make it a valuable component in a wide range of personal care products.
